An application that brings these stores closer to the people.Ivan LyubeyZethu MabuzeInts MancassRobins ReinsSamet HaliliChwayita BacaHack The WasteContents TOC \o "1-3" \h \z \u Project Scope PAGEREF _Toc40514665 \h 2Business Model PAGEREF _Toc40514666 \h 3Marketing Plan PAGEREF _Toc40514667 \h 3Market Plan Implementation PAGEREF _Toc40514668 \h 4Budget PAGEREF _Toc40514669 \h 6SWOT analysis PAGEREF _Toc40514670 \h 8Risk Analysis/Assessment PAGEREF _Toc40514671 \h 9Project ScopeOur business proposal is to create an application that the end users can use to search for stores that sell food without packaging near them. This application will make use of an API that will track their location and give pop up suggestions of the nearest stores. This API will be integrated to our main application interface that will be downloaded and used by the user. The API is a tool that will allow the user to plan routes amongst many other things. Our application will make use of a simplistic and easy to understand interface so that people from different backgrounds, are able to use it seamlessly. Business needs we satisfy: A new source of customers getting knowledge about these stores. The demographic we wish to reach varies. From people of different tastes, preference, lifestyle choices and habits but similarly, all with one main objective, cutting the usage plastic. Our target audience will be 13 - 45 year old people of any gender which are already slightly interested in the eco-friendly lifestyle, or would like to adapt and learn more about it. Despite our “seemingly” filtered audience, we do not wish to exclude people outside this range.Research says that 26% of all plastic waste is caused by packaging alone. Despite the fact that some foods require packaging, there is a number of those packaged in plastic that could do without the plastic packaging. We want to decrease the number of plastic packaging used in the world and introduce society to packageless stores. This implementation does not only benefit the consumer but the World on a greater scale. The reduction of industrial use of this toxic packaging could reduce the carbon footprint. Inversely saving humanity-the consumer. This application is creating value for companies that offer locally sourced or packageless products and consumers who are socially responsible and want to save both the earth and money. According to our market research, we found that amongst our application is most likely to succeed owing to two main types of people:Psychographic: people interested in zero waste and who are willing to sacrifice the comfort of store made packaging to save some money, save the environment, and order the exact amount of food necessary which. In a few words – Socially responsible people. Behavioural: People who are interested in loyalty programs, who want to save some money and buy the exact amounts they need not the amounts given in packages. With this in mind, we have a broad idea on which concepts to make use of for a greater consumer force. The market potential is exponential. The trend for eco-friendly products is ever-growing and the retail food and market industries turnover in 2016 was 1192 billion euro in Europe. This product is in growth stage of product life cycle because the zero waste movement and community is growing and people are becoming more socially responsible. Market Plan ImplementationMake a motto which will stay in our target audiences mind. “Don’t waste money on packaging and save the world!”.? With this motto we will advertisements on social media platforms (Instagram, Facebook, Twitter and tiktok), where popular people and influencers will generate traction around it, with an emphasis on saving money and animals. We expect that with these advertisements people will understand that breaking this habit will not only save their money, but the environment too! Educate people about? plastic pollution. Make seminars, workshops and physical activities. Make sure that everybody understands what is happening in the world and what they can do to change their future. Show them how they can impact plastic pollution. We have to make materials which show the difference between world without plastic pollution and with it. Make a loyalty system in our app.? When somebody signs up in our app, they get 10 loyalty points for an opportunity to change the world - try to make world without unnecessary waste from packaging. Users of the application can invite friends or shop at packageless stores to get more loyalty points and exchange them with products or vouchers form packageless? shops.
